It's available now on most online book stores including Amazon(RRP ?8.99)as well as on Kindle (RRP ?3.99).VINALOGY offers a different take on learning about wine, using storytelling, imagery and analogy (vinalogies) instead of dull winemaking facts. Did you know that Cabernet Sauvignon was the rugby player of wine grapes, for example? Or that Pinot Noir was the ballerina? VINALOGY focusses on the real building blocks of wine: the top ten red and white grape varieties and answers those frequently asked wine questions.More info can be found on my website http://www.winebird.co.ukThanks very much for reading.
